| # --------------------------------------------------- |
| # Feature flags |
| # --------------------------------------------------- |
| # Feature flags that are set by default go here. Their values can be |
| # overwritten by those specified under FEATURE_FLAGS in super_config.py |
| # For example, DEFAULT_FEATURE_FLAGS = { 'FOO': True, 'BAR': False } here |
| # and FEATURE_FLAGS = { 'BAR': True, 'BAZ': True } in superset_config.py |
| # will result in combined feature flags of { 'FOO': True, 'BAR': True, 'BAZ': True } |
| DEFAULT_FEATURE_FLAGS = { |
| # Experimental feature introducing a client (browser) cache |
| "CLIENT_CACHE": False, |
| "ENABLE_EXPLORE_JSON_CSRF_PROTECTION": False, |
| "PRESTO_EXPAND_DATA": False, |
| } |
| |
| # A function that receives a dict of all feature flags |
| # (DEFAULT_FEATURE_FLAGS merged with FEATURE_FLAGS) |
| # can alter it, and returns a similar dict. Note the dict of feature |
| # flags passed to the function is a deepcopy of the dict in the config, |
| # and can therefore be mutated without side-effect |
| # |
| # GET_FEATURE_FLAGS_FUNC can be used to implement progressive rollouts, |
| # role-based features, or a full on A/B testing framework. |
| # |
| # from flask import g, request |
| # def GET_FEATURE_FLAGS_FUNC(feature_flags_dict): |
| # feature_flags_dict['some_feature'] = g.user and g.user.id == 5 |
| # return feature_flags_dict |
| GET_FEATURE_FLAGS_FUNC = None |

| # --------------------------------------------------- |
| # Time grain configurations |
| # --------------------------------------------------- |
| # List of time grains to disable in the application (see list of builtin |
| # time grains in superset/db_engine_specs.builtin_time_grains). |
| # For example: to disable 1 second time grain: |
| # TIME_GRAIN_BLACKLIST = ['PT1S'] |
| TIME_GRAIN_BLACKLIST: List[str] = [] |
| |
| # Additional time grains to be supported using similar definitions as in |
| # superset/db_engine_specs.builtin_time_grains. |
| # For example: To add a new 2 second time grain: |
| # TIME_GRAIN_ADDONS = {'PT2S': '2 second'} |
| TIME_GRAIN_ADDONS: Dict[str, str] = {} |
| |
| # Implementation of additional time grains per engine. |
| # For example: To implement 2 second time grain on clickhouse engine: |
| # TIME_GRAIN_ADDON_FUNCTIONS = { |
| # 'clickhouse': { |
| # 'PT2S': 'toDateTime(intDiv(toUInt32(toDateTime({col})), 2)*2)' |
| # } |
| # } |
| TIME_GRAIN_ADDON_FUNCTIONS: Dict[str, Dict[str, str]] = {} |

| # A callable that allows altering the database conneciton URL and params |
| # on the fly, at runtime. This allows for things like impersonation or |
| # arbitrary logic. For instance you can wire different users to |
| # use different connection parameters, or pass their email address as the |
| # username. The function receives the connection uri object, connection |
| # params, the username, and returns the mutated uri and params objects. |
| # Example: |
| # def DB_CONNECTION_MUTATOR(uri, params, username, security_manager, source): |
| # user = security_manager.find_user(username=username) |
| # if user and user.email: |
| # uri.username = user.email |
| # return uri, params |
| # |
| # Note that the returned uri and params are passed directly to sqlalchemy's |
| # as such `create_engine(url, **params)` |
| DB_CONNECTION_MUTATOR = None |
| |
| # A function that intercepts the SQL to be executed and can alter it. |
| # The use case is can be around adding some sort of comment header |
| # with information such as the username and worker node information |
| # |
| # def SQL_QUERY_MUTATOR(sql, username, security_manager): |
| # dttm = datetime.now().isoformat() |
| # return f"-- [SQL LAB] {username} {dttm}\n{sql}" |
| SQL_QUERY_MUTATOR = None |
